Product Overview

Chemguard AP14341 Ruggedized Interface Module: Industrial Resilience for Harsh Environments

The Chemguard AP14341 Interface Module (SKU: AP14341 / 0021-18439 / 0020-35993) is a ruggedized EMC chassis signal routing board engineered for continuous, fault-tolerant operation in the most demanding industrial environments. Designed to serve as the critical signal backbone within fire suppression and industrial control system architectures, this module delivers reliable I/O routing, EMC-compliant signal conditioning, and chassis-level integration across a wide range of operating conditions — including high ambient temperatures, elevated humidity, airborne particulates, mechanical vibration, and electromagnetic interference.

Rugged Specifications Table

Parameter Specification / Detail
Part Number / SKU AP14341 | 0021-18439 | 0020-35993
Brand Chemguard
Module Type EMC Chassis Signal Routing / Interface Board
Series AP-Series Industrial Interface Modules
Form Factor Chassis-mount PCB module
Operating Temperature -20°C to +70°C (industrial grade)
Storage Temperature -40°C to +85°C
Humidity Tolerance 5% to 95% RH, non-condensing
EMC Protection Shielded chassis interface, conformal-coated PCB
Vibration Resistance Compliant with IEC 60068-2-6 (sinusoidal vibration)
Ingress Protection Panel/chassis-mounted; IP20 equivalent in enclosed cabinet
Signal Routing Multi-channel I/O signal distribution within EMC chassis
Compatibility Chemguard AP-Series control panels, EMC chassis backplanes
